The Lecturer’s Survival Guide

Serving as a comprehensive introduction to those new to teaching in higher education, this essential guide discusses pedagogical approaches that are current in higher education and the wider responsibilities of teaching within higher education. This book outlines the key aspects of navigating the role, including becoming a personal tutor and supporting the needs of a diverse student body. Readers will benefit from advice on promoting wellness, best practice while teaching and enjoying their role as they embark on their first academic job. This book serves the need for developing an insight and understanding of the cutting-edge innovation in Cloud technology. It provides an understanding of cutting-edge innovations, paradigms, and security by using real-life applications, case studies, and examples. This book provides a holistic view of cloud technology theories, practices, and future applications with real-life examples. It comprehensively explains cloud technology, design principles, development trends, maintaining state-of-the-art cloud computing and software services. It describes how cloud technology can transform the operating contexts of business enterprises. It exemplifies the potential of cloud computing for next-generation computational excellence and the role it plays as a key driver for the 4th industrial revolution in Industrial Engineering and a key driver for manufacturing industries. Researchers, academicians, postgraduates, and industry specialists will find this book of interest.

This book explores the critical role of sustainability in shaping the future of education, business, and environmental energy solutions. It highlights innovative approaches to understanding and addressing challenges such as sustainable energy practices, the adoption of environmentally friendly technologies, and the integration of sustainability principles into business strategies and educational frameworks. Also, it covers issues, including the adoption of electric vehicles, the influence of cultural and institutional factors on sustainable practices, the impact of lighting and environmental conditions on worker productivity, and the importance of security in digital systems. Additionally, it examines how educational institutions can foster sustainable development, the use of advanced technologies in enhancing learning and assessment, and the broader societal implications of sustainable practices in various industries. Furthermore, the book provides valuable insights into how sustainability can be effectively integrated into key areas of modern life to promote a more sustainable and resilient future.
